Pelicans' Anthony Davis voted an All-Star Game starter for the third time
New Orleans Pelicans forward/center Anthony Davis was voted in as a starter for the 2018 NBA All-Star Game.
Davis will be making his fifth consecutive All-Star game appearance and his third as a starter. The Brow is having an MVP caliber season as he sits in the top-10 of points (26.7), rebounds (10.5), and blocks (2.1) per game while ranking fifth in PER (28.8) and win shares (7.2).
Davis currently owns a 9.8 nERD rating, good for third among all 486 NBA players this season.
